The cell site is a location or a point; the cell is a wide geographical area. The picture illustrates the cell structure. Some people historically saw the cell as the blue hexagon shown, being defined by the cell site in the center and the antenna coverage being the coverage of the ... WebSectorization, that is, splitting an existing cell into two or more cells is discussed in Section 13.3.4 and illustrated in Fig. 13.3.Performance of sectorization is scenario dependent and works best in high load scenarios with good coverage. Hence, sectorization is generally said to be a capacity feature and not a coverage feature.
